Authors and mathematicians among Gr 1s at FJL Wells Primary

The Herald spoke to some Gr 1s at FJL Wells Primary Mine School about their first day and want they want to be in the future.

Excitement was in the air last week as FJL Wells Primary Mine School welcomed their new bunch of Grade Ones for the new academic year.

Iminathi Phaidi was very excited to start school and told the Randfontein Herald he wanted to pass with flying colours. He further enjoys writing and cannot wait to finish school one day. His biggest challenge, however, is Mathematics in Afrikaans. To add, his favourite snack is Doritos and food none other than a pizza. He also believes that he is the strongest Grade One in school.

Lwandle Mthembu is also excited to learn and enjoys colouring in and reading adventurous stories. He thinks his biggest challenge in Grade One will be to count to 100.

Munashe Maamogwa said she is now a big girl in a big school and can cook all by herself. She wants to better her skill in writing and wants to become a world-famous author one day.
